買菜系統中如何實現購物車中商品數量的即時更新功能?
買菜系統中如何實現購物車中商品數量的即時更新功能?
在現代社會,越來越多的人選擇透過網路購買食材,而不是親自去市場購買。為了方便顧客的購物體驗,許多購物平台都提供了買菜系統。在這個系統中,顧客可以選擇自己需要的食材,並將其加入購物車。然而,在購物車中,商品數量的即時更新功能是非常重要的,因為當顧客添加或刪除商品時,購物車中的數量需要及時更新,以便顧客可以了解自己購買的食材的準確數量。
在買菜系統中,實現購物車中商品數量的即時更新功能可以透過以下幾個步驟來實現:
- 設計資料庫結構:首先,需要設計一個資料庫表來儲存購物車中的商品資訊。這個表格可以包含商品ID、商品名稱、商品數量等欄位。同時,也可以建立一個使用者表,用於儲存使用者的相關資訊。
- 新增商品到購物車:當顧客在網站上選擇商品時,系統可以將商品的ID和數量加入購物車表。同時,系統需要判斷該商品是否已經在購物車中存在,如果存在,則更新商品的數量,如果不存在,則添加新的數據。
- 更新購物車中商品數量:當顧客在購物車中增加或減少商品數量時,系統需要即時更新購物車表中相應商品的數量。可以透過監聽購物車中的加減按鈕事件,當按鈕被點擊時,系統就可以更新購物車中商品的數量。
- 展示購物車中的商品數量:為了讓顧客了解購物車中商品的即時數量,系統可以在購物車頁面上顯示商品數量。可以透過從購物車表中查詢對應商品的數量,並將其展示在頁面上。
- 同步商品數量: 當顧客確認購買時,系統需要將購物車中的商品數量同步到訂單表中。這樣,在產生訂單時,系統可以根據購物車中的商品數量來計算總價,並更新庫存資訊。
透過以上步驟,買菜系統就可以實現購物車中商品數量的即時更新功能。這樣,顧客不僅可以方便地了解購物車中商品的準確數量,還可以及時調整購物車中商品的數量,以滿足自己的需求。同時,對商家來說,也可以即時掌握顧客的購買需求,為他們提供更好的服務。
總之,購物車中商品數量的即時更新功能對於買菜系統來說是非常重要的。透過設計資料庫結構和即時更新購物車表中的商品數量,系統可以有效地實現此功能。這不僅可以提升顧客的購物體驗,也可以滿足商家對即時銷售數據的需求。
以上是買菜系統中如何實現購物車中商品數量的即時更新功能?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

熱AI工具

Undresser.AI Undress
人工智慧驅動的應用程序,用於創建逼真的裸體照片

AI Clothes Remover
用於從照片中去除衣服的線上人工智慧工具。

Undress AI Tool
免費脫衣圖片

Clothoff.io
AI脫衣器

Video Face Swap
使用我們完全免費的人工智慧換臉工具,輕鬆在任何影片中換臉!

熱門文章

熱工具

記事本++7.3.1
好用且免費的程式碼編輯器

SublimeText3漢化版
中文版,非常好用

禪工作室 13.0.1
強大的PHP整合開發環境

Dreamweaver CS6
視覺化網頁開發工具

SublimeText3 Mac版
神級程式碼編輯軟體(SublimeText3)

如何在FastAPI中使用推播通知來即時更新資料引言:隨著網路的不斷發展,即時資料更新變得越來越重要。例如,在即時交易、即時監控和即時遊戲等應用程式場景中,我們需要及時更新數據以提供最準確的資訊和最佳的用戶體驗。 FastAPI是一個基於Python的現代Web框架,它提供了一種簡單且高效的方式來建立高效能的網路應用程式。本文將介紹如何使用FastAPI來實

Java中如何實作一個簡單的購物車功能?購物車是線上商店的重要功能,它允許用戶將想要購買的商品添加到購物車中,並對商品進行管理。在Java中,我們可以透過使用物件導向的方式來實作一個簡單的購物車功能。首先,我們需要定義一個商品類。此類別包含商品的名稱、價格和數量等屬性,以及對應的Getter和Setter方法。例如:publicclassProduct

如何使用Vue和ElementPlus實現即時更新和即時顯示引言:Vue是一款前端框架,提供了即時回應和資料綁定的特性,使得我們能夠快速建立互動的使用者介面。而ElementPlus是一個基於Vue3的元件庫,提供了豐富的UI元件,讓開發者更方便地建立應用程式。在許多場景下,我們需要實現即時更新和即時顯示的功能,例如聊天應用程式、即時數

在我們日常生活中,網上購物已成為非常普遍的消費方式,而購物車功能也是網上購物的重要組成部分之一。那麼,本文將為大家介紹如何利用PHP語言來實現購物車的相關功能。一、技術背景購物車是一種線上購物網站常見的功能。當使用者在一個網站上瀏覽一些商品,他們可以將這些商品添加到一個虛擬的購物車中,以便於在後續的結帳過程中選擇和管理。購物車通常包括以下基本功能:新增商品:

如何使用Vue實現即時更新的統計圖表引言:隨著互聯網的快速發展和數據的爆炸增長,數據視覺化成為了一種越來越重要的方式來傳達資訊和分析數據。而在前端開發中,Vue框架作為一種流行的JavaScript框架,可以幫助我們更有效率地建立互動式的資料視覺化圖表。本文將介紹如何使用Vue實現一個即時更新的統計圖表,透過WebSocket即時取得資料並更新圖表,同時給出相

實戰教學:PHP和MySQL實現購物車功能詳解購物車功能是網站開發中常見的功能之一,透過購物車使用者可以輕鬆地將想要購買的商品加入購物車,然後進行結算和付款。在這篇文章中,我們將詳細介紹如何使用PHP和MySQL實作一個簡單的購物車功能,並提供具體的程式碼範例。建立資料庫和資料表首先需要在MySQL資料庫中建立一個用來儲存商品資訊的資料表。以下是一個簡單的數據表

如何透過Vue和ElementPlus實現資料的即時更新和即時展示引言:Vue是一款流行的前端框架,是建立使用者介面的漸進式框架。 ElementPlus是基於Vue3.0的桌面端元件庫,提供了豐富的UI元件和工具,能夠幫助開發者快速建立漂亮的介面。在實際開發中,我們常常需要實現數據的即時更新和即時展示的功能,這篇文章將基於Vue和

如何利用Redis和JavaScript實現購物車功能購物車是電商網站中非常常見的功能之一,它允許用戶將感興趣的商品添加到購物車中,方便用戶隨時查看和管理購買的商品。在本文中,我們將介紹如何利用Redis和JavaScript實現購物車功能,並提供具體的程式碼範例。一、準備工作在開始之前,我們需要確保已經安裝並配置Redis,可以透過官方網站[https:/
